In a tragic incident in Shiroro Local Government Area of Niger State, Pastor Joshua Musa was killed by bandits even after a ransom had been paid for his release.

Pastor Musa, originally from Nasarawa State, served at the Evangelical Church of West Africa (ECWA) in the Sarkin Pawa Community before his untimely death.

The harrowing event unfolded when Pastor Musa, along with his wife and several others, were kidnapped by bandits seven days ago.

Despite the payment of the demanded ransom, which led to their initial release, the bandits brutally killed Pastor Musa as they were leaving the kidnapping site.

His wife and the other victims were spared and allowed to return home.

The loss has deeply affected the community and members of the ECWA, prompting an outpouring of grief on social media.

A church member, Sunny Danbaba, expressed his sorrow online, stating, “This pastor and his wife were kidnapped at Shiroro DCC. After payment to release them, on their way coming out of the bush, they killed him.”

The motive behind the murder, especially after receiving the ransom, remains unclear, adding to the fears and concerns of the local population regarding the escalating bandit activities in the region.

As of this report, the spokesperson of the state police command, Wasiu Abiodun, has yet to release an official statement on the incident.

Nigerians are experiencing more pain as the prices of prepaid electricity meters have gone up after seven weeks of the electricity tariff hike on April 3.

This comes after the Nigerian Electricity Regulatory Commission announced the deregulation of Meter Asset Provider.

Recall that on April 30, NERC, in a statement signed by its Chairman, Sanusi Garba, and Commissioner of Legal, Licensing, and Compliance, Dafe Akpeneye, removed electricity meter price capping.

 

Before NERC announced the meter price deregulation, electricity distribution companies sold single and three-phased meters at a capped price of N81,975.16 and N143,836.16. However, a recent meter price announcement by Discos showed that the price of single and three meters have surged to as high as N135,240.01 and N241,875.00, depending on the vendor company.

DAILY POST gathered that the Abuja Electricity Company quoted between N91,835.10 and N135,240.01 for single-phased metres by different metre vendors. Also, AEDC said the price of a three-phase metre is between N160,646.93 and N241,875.00.

Eko Electricity Distribution Company’s new meter prices increased from N122,337.76 to N167,700 for a single-phase meter. Also, the phase meter rose to N206.737.42 and N258,000.

Meanwhile, the Minister of Power, Adebayo Adelabu, said in a ministerial briefing in Abuja last week that Nigerians’ experience following the electricity tariff hike is temporary.

Meanwhile, outside of rising energy costs, Nigerians have continued to groan over the untamed rise in the cost of food, as food inflation increased to 40.53 percent in April 2024.

The Sultan of Sokoto, Alhaji Sa’ad Abubakar lll, has underscored the importance of education in having an enlightened and informed population and also building a prosperous society

This is even as he decried the widespread begging on the street among Almajiri students.

 

He warned that northern leaders cannot educate children by leaving them begging on the streets of cities and towns.

The Sultan voiced his discontent when he spoke at the inauguration of the Zamfara State Almajiri Integrated Qur’anic Education Center,Gummi held in Gummi on Sunday.

 

“I am not a politician but I’m here because of the importance I attach to the programme to me and community at large.

 

“Qur’anic Schools are centers where religious education and values were inculcated to children, but the only source of concern was begging among almajiri students”, the Sultan said

He stated that construction of Integrated Schools is very critical to needs of society as it goes a long way in addressing out of school children and end begging in the name of learning.

He said every government must put education at the forefront, believing that all good things come from education and all bad were from ignorance.

Speaking at the event, Gov. Dauda Lawal of Zamfara said the government would protect the future of younger ones by creating a conducive and enabling environment for them grow and thrive.

He added that in addition to 6 class rooms of 45 students capacity and130 double bed space, 12 toilet facilities and kitchen, a vocational center to train children on wood work, sowing, Messing work among others were established.

He assured the people of government commitment in providing adequate feeding and other wellbeing of the students.

The governor named the center after Sultan Sa’ad Abubakar III.

The governor also inaugurated the upgraded and renovated General Hospital in Nasarwa Burkullu in Bukkuyum Local Government Area of the state, and Maru Genera Hospital which was also renovated
